Job description:

Applications are invited for a postdoctoral research associate (PDRA) to join a collaborative research programme with the aim to gain understanding of the mechanisms and the role of synaptic dysfunction and impaired neurotransmission in amyotrophic lateral sclerosis and frontotemporal dementia (ALS/FTD).

You will work within a team of two postdoctoral research assistants and two senior research technicians under a 5-year MRC-funded collaborative research programme. The programme will involve electrophysiological and microscopy-based interrogation of synaptic function in vitro in human induced pluripotent stem cell (iPSC) models of ALS/FTD and primary neuron cultures. Further, this work will investigate underlying mechanisms using high-resolution genetic and biochemical perturbations combined with state-of-the art proteomics and determine the role of synaptic dysfunction as a driver of disease using Drosophila models.

In this post you will lead the maintenance of curated iPSCs and the generation of iPSC-derived neuronal cultures in which synaptic function will be examined using state-of-the-art electrophysiological and microscopy-based assays. You will contribute to all other aspects of the project, including the investigations of underlying mechanisms. Under direction of the PIs, you will be expected to design, execute and interpret experiments, compile reports and publications, and to present at lab group and scientific meetings, as well as to coordinate and direct the work of the technicians supporting the project.
